“Paranormal Activity” scares up most movie frights at Halloween
Vampires may be one of the most popular current themes in entertainment, but movies that feature exorcisms and Satan give audiences the biggest scare.
With Halloween fast approaching, a poll on website Movies.com found that vampiresĀ give moviegoers less of a fright than creepy kids or Zombies.
(Has the romance factor of the “Twilight” saga, along with all those popular vegetarian vampires, meant that good old blood-suckers are losing some street cred?)
In the Movies.com poll, some 44 percent of the 5,000 responders get the best scares out of films that focus on exorcism
andĀ Satan or ghosts and haunting. Vampires were rated scary by just 3.6 percent of those taking part.
